[PATCH 1/2] virtio-mmio: Parse a range of IRQ numbers passed on the command line

From: Jakub Sitnicki
Date: Fri Sep 29 2023 - 16:46:41 EST


virtio-mmio devices in theory can use multiple interrupts. However, the
existing virtio-mmio command line configuration format does not provide a
way to express it.

Extend the configuration format so that the user can specify an IRQ
range. This prepares ground for registering multiple IRQs per device.

Because we need to stay backward compatible with VMMs which don't yet use
the new format, fall back to the old one if we fail to find an IRQ range in
the passed parameters.

@@ -39,11 +39,12 @@
* 3. Kernel module (or command line) parameter. Can be used more than once -
* one device will be created for each one. Syntax:
*
- * [virtio_mmio.]device=<size>@<baseaddr>:<irq>[:<id>]
+ * [virtio_mmio.]device=<size>@<baseaddr>:<irq>[-<irq last>][:<id>]
* where:
* <size> := size (can use standard suffixes like K, M or G)
* <baseaddr> := physical base address
- * <irq> := interrupt number (as passed to request_irq())
+ * <irq> := first interrupt number (as passed to request_irq())
+ * <irq last> := (optional) last interrupt number
* <id> := (optional) platform device id
* eg.:
* virtio_mmio.device=0x100@0x100b0000:48 \
